Mobilink hails decision on SMS tax withdrawal - News

http://www.dailytimes.com.pk

KARACHI: Mobilink, the country's leading cellular company and part of Orascom Telecom has hailed the government's decision to withdraw the proposed 20 paisa Federal Excise Duty on SMS. Mobilink also appreciated the support and foresight of the Pakistan Telecommunication Authority (PTA) to create a taxation environment that was beneficial to the consumers and the progress and development of the telecom sector in the long run. Director Public Relations Mobilink, Omar Manzur said, "The telecom industry has shown tremendous growth during the past decade and has been able to channel enormous foreign investments into the country. staff report

Waridtel, Zong, Ufone, Telenor, Mobilink sms service center numbers - Telecom

  • Enter Menu Mode on your hand phone
  • Select \"Messages\" or \"Mail\"
  • Select \"Message Setting\"
  • Select \"SMS Centre\"‚ \"Message Centre Number\"‚ \"Route Centre\" or its equivalent
  • Enter Message Centre Number:
  • Ufone sms service center number +923330005150 or 00923330005150
    Waridtel Service sms center number +9232100006001 or 00923210006001
    
    Telenor Pakistan sms service center number +923455000010 or 00923455000010
    Zong Pakistan sms service center number +923040000011 or 00923040000011
    Mobilink Pakistan sms service center number +92300000042 or 0092300000042

    Pakistan cellular networks GPRS/EDGE speed comparison

    Here are the GPRS/EDGE speed comparisons of Pakistani mobile networks which I did in about two weeks using SonyEricsson J300i and Nokia 6600, Nokia N70 mobile devices. My Location was Faisalabad city(Third largest city of Paksitan). As I'm living in big city surrounded by mobile signal towers got no signal problems, in short signals quality was good by all networks. In the chart below I am comparing Ufone, Zong Pakistan, Telenor Pakistan, Waridtel Pakistan and Mobilink Pakistan (Currently these are the networks in Pakistan who are providing GPRS/EDGE mobile internet data services).

    http://chartgizmo.com/GenerateChart?id=4982

    In the chart below is average GPRS disconnections comparison by the networks of every day. Ufone and Mobilink are the baddest gprs service providers (at least these days). Ufone GPRS is useless at nights and Mobilink's gprs is 24hours useless too many disconnections the more you connect the more you are charged for the data packets (64KB). Telenor Pakistan gives 4 confirm disconnections every day and at set times, one at midnight(12am), one in the morning(7am), one afternoon(12pm and one at evening(6pm). Telenor keeps on making difference between their disconnection times. Only Zong and Warid provides 24hours gprs service without any disconnection.

    http://chartgizmo.com/GenerateChart?id=4984


    Some other things you should know:

    • Only Zong is providing different type of data packages, 8kb chunks package, 64kb packets package, time based package.
    • Only Zong is providing Unlimited GPRS/EDGE package in Pakistan and Mobilink(mobilink have unlimited data package for postpaid customers only), all others are fooling their customers and Telenor Paksitan is at top in fooling their customers in all kind of mobile phone packages and rates. In fact others have limits in their UNLIMITED gprs packages :)
